Least Common Multiple of 94020 and 94030 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 94020 and 94030, than apply into the LCM equation.

GCF(94020,94030) = 10
LCM(94020,94030) = ( 94020 × 94030) / 10
LCM(94020,94030) = 8840700600 / 10
LCM(94020,94030) = 884070060
